Output e3cf8661f7d84daf2b2b4c176bfa6889812d7acbff6ff521e39f974c8a7d98ca:13

value
20404948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52d2f357a0bcca4689bdb77a5f691b546cf9d07a OP_EQUALVERIFY OP_CHECKSIG
address
18Yw7qEjxEsm89CxXtEYnR1NBzs52Ygh1H
transaction
e3cf8661f7d84daf2b2b4c176bfa6889812d7acbff6ff521e39f974c8a7d98ca
spent
true